Marketing is of the hottest bachelor's degree programs in the United States, coming in as the #11 most popular major in the country. So, there are lots of possibilities to explore when you're trying to determine where you want to get your degree.

In 2024, College Factual analyzed 132 schools in order to identify the top ones for its Best Marketing Bachelor's Degree Schools in the Great Lakes Region ranking. Combined, these schools handed out 8,627 bachelor's degrees in marketing to qualified students.

Overall Quality Is a Must

A school that excels in educating for a particular major and degree level must be a great school overall as well. To make it into this list a school must rank well in our overall Best Colleges ranking. This ranking considered factors such as graduation rates, overall graduate earnings and other educational resources to identify great colleges and universities.

Average Early-Career Salaries

Average early-career salary of those graduating with their bachelor's degree is one indicator we use in our analysis to find the schools that offer the highest-quality education. After all, your bachelor's degree won't mean much if it doesn't help you find a job that will help you earn a living.
